Output c777b14a10193f34b6cbf9d2907273555028e26910df23abe70f89beb62918a6:24

value
462736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db89365deb3d8a2fdfce5ca70eae3f9fc955ba34 OP_EQUAL
address
3MhpHEiQ7AGDt64Nrkz7Vi6PrKRpW8ADfL
transaction
c777b14a10193f34b6cbf9d2907273555028e26910df23abe70f89beb62918a6
confirmations
235501
spent
true